OpenHIS
Hospital Information System
This is an open source hospital information system designed for small or large facility. It contains all the essential modules for running a hospital from patient registration to billing. Built entirely on top of open source technologies to ensure sustainability and great support from community.

Special Feature

Web-based application for fast deployment and easy access.

Consultation notes with clinical pathways.

Coded operational dataset ready to use from drugs, consumable items to consultation fees.

Possible drug prescription database built into the order function.
Modules
- Patient registration, appointment & scheduling
- Admission, Queue, Discharge and Transfer
- Clinical Consultation
- Order Management
- Ward & Bed Management
- Diet & Kitchen Management
- Inventory & Stock management
- Drug Information & Prescription
- Custom Forms
- Patient Billing
- Medical Record
- Reports & Print-outs
- Integration/sharing data via RestAPI
Training Scripts
OpenHIS uses a custom training application to train users on how to use the application. Users will follow a set of instructions to peform daily task such as patient registration, consultation or bill creation. Progress of each user will be recorded and their proficiency can be monitored by supervisors. The training application can be accessed at:

Open Source Technologies
The application was designed and built entirely with open source techonologies.
- Linux
- PHP
- Laravel
- MySQL
License
OpenHIS is open-sourced software licensed under the GNU General Public License v3.0
